Hi guys I've been sidetracked in wargames for a year or two but now I hear MSFS 2020 has just been released, so can I ask a stupid question- shall I buy it from Steam or somewhere else?

From past experience I know that Steam download times can be horrendously long so I'd prefer to buy it from somewhere else with a faster d/l time if possible, any recommendations?

Your only options are the Microsoft Store, Steam, or the boxed set from Aerosoft (only for those in Europe though). An additional option is the Xbox Game Pass for PC subscription from Microsoft. At the moment there is a deal in most countries where you can sign up for one month for $1. Not a bad deal to try the Standard version of the sim before buying outright.

Note that there have been download and installation issues from both the Microsoft Store and Steam.

Is there a purchasing mode which avoids running the sim connected to internet as it happens with Steam ?

Thanks

 

There is an offline mode, though you need to be connected when enabling it so it can be verified. After that you can fly offline. However, you will lose the streamed scenery when doing so.
